So, what's the big deal with this credit? While Texas doesn't have its own state income tax credit specifically for solar, Texans absolutely benefit from a fantastic federal program called the Residential Clean Energy Credit (you might remember it as the Investment Tax Credit, or ITC). Let's talk numbers and what this really means. Currently, the federal Residential Clean Energy Credit offers a massive 30% tax credit for qualifying solar systems installed in your home. This isn't just a deduction; it's a dollar-for-dollar reduction in the income taxes you owe. For example, if your solar system costs $30,000 to install, you could get a $9,000 credit back! This applies to the cost of the solar panels, inverters, mounting equipment, and even the installation labor. The beauty of it is that it's not a one-size-fits-all loan or rebate; it's a credit you claim when you file your federal taxes. Beyond this federal incentive, some Texas cities and utility companies also offer their own local rebates or programs. For instance, cities like Austin and San Antonio, and utilities like Oncor or CenterPoint, sometimes have unique incentives that can stack on top of the federal credit, making the deal even sweeter. It's worth remembering that these local programs can vary significantly and change often, so it's always good to check what's available in your specific area.

Ready to jump on the solar bandwagon? Here are some simple, practical tips to get you started. First, do your homework! Find a few reputable local solar installers and get multiple quotes. Don't be afraid to ask questions about the system, warranty, and how they handle the tax credit documentation. Second, understand that this is a tax credit, not an immediate cash rebate. You'll claim it when you file your federal income taxes, so it's essential to have sufficient tax liability to take full advantage of it. Consult with a tax professional if you have any doubts. Third, always inquire about any specific local incentives in your city or through your utility provider. These can be crucial in further reducing your out-of-pocket costs. Finally, consider your long-term energy needs. Solar is a significant investment that pays dividends over decades, so think about your future energy consumption and how solar can best meet it.
